Default heater controls

my floor vent on the passenger side doesnt blow any air at all. the driverside works fine. is there a vaccum line on these or what? thanks in advance

Default RE: heater controls

Have someone turn the mode **** and someone else look at the actuators and see if they move. Or apply vacuum at the actuators. You could have a broken bleed door or actuator.
